As many as 42 deaths the highest in four months were reported during the last 24 hours due to novel coronavirus while 5830 persons tested positive.

As per the National Command and Operation Center (NCOC) latest data 59786 tests were conducted of which 5,830 retruend positie taking the total number of positive cases to 1,442,263..

The positivity ratio stands at 9.75 percent.
According to province wise details 546,141 coronavirus cases have been reported in Sindh, 483,779 in Punjab 197,937 in Khyber Pakhtunkhwa 129,758 in Islamabad, 39,323 in Azad Kashmir 34,557 in Balochistan and 10,768 in Gilgit-Baltistan so far. .

With 42 casualties during the last 24 hours the tally of fatalities has soared to 29372.

13,201 persons have succumbed to the epidemic in Punjab, 7,849 in Sindh 6,023 in KP, 982 in Islamabad, 760 in Azad Kashmir, 368 in Balochistan, and 189 in GB so far.

Pakistan has so far conducted 25,194,561 coronavirus tests and 59,786 in the last 24 hours. 1,312,819 patients have recovered in the country whereas 1,590 patients are in critical condition.
177,483,355 doses have so far been administered in the country.
